Situations we see in Santa Clara

Doorbell chimes weakly or not at all

Video doorbells need more power than a 1960s transformer delivers. Replacing it is a small job with an immediate result.

Thermostat needs a C-wire

Common in older homes. We pull a new thermostat cable rather than relying on power-stealing adapters that cause intermittent faults.

Smart switch has no neutral

Older Santa Clara switch loops carry no neutral. We either pull one, relocate the switch leg, or specify a no-neutral device that works with your fixture.

Wi-Fi dead spots

More mesh nodes on bad backhaul won't fix it. A CAT6 run to a ceiling access point will, permanently.

Smart Home Wiring in Santa Clara — questions

Can you install smart switches in an older Santa Clara home?

Usually yes, but it depends on whether the switch box has a neutral. We check first and tell you which devices will work in your specific boxes before you buy anything.

Will my smart lighting still work if the internet goes down?

Local-control systems keep working on the wall switch and keypads. Cloud-only devices may lose scenes and schedules, which is why we prefer local control for lighting.

Can you run ethernet in a house with no attic access?

Often, using closets, chases and stacked walls. We survey the route and tell you honestly what is reachable and what would mean drywall repair.

Is hardwired better than wireless for cameras?

For reliability, yes. A PoE camera has power and data on one cable and does not drop off your network. Wireless is fine for renters and quick coverage.

Do you do smart home wiring for Santa Clara remodels?

Yes, and that is the ideal time. Open walls make structured cabling cheap, and pre-wiring for future devices costs a fraction of retrofitting later.
